菱形代码

 1 package Lingxing;
 2
 3 public class lingxing {
 4
 5     public static void main(String[] args)
 6 {
 7                    for (int h=0; h<10; h++)
 8         {
 9             for (int l=8; l>=h; l--)
10             {
11                 System.out.print(" ");
12             }
13             for (int m=0; m<=h; m++)
14             {
15                 System.out.print("*");
16             }
17             for (int n=1; n<=h; n++)
18             {
19                 System.out.print("*");
20             }
21             System.out.println();
22         }
23         for (int o=0; o<10; o++)
24         {
25             for (int p=0; p<=o; p++)
26             {
27                 System.out.print(" ");
28             }
29             for (int q=8; q>=o; q--)
30             {
31                 System.out.print("*");
32             }
33             for (int r=7; r>=o; r--)
34             {
35                 System.out.print("*");
36             }
37             System.out.println();
38         }
39     }
40
41 }

Lingxing

时间: 2024-08-09 18:53:39

菱形代码的相关文章

c++命令提示符窗口下打印指定大小的菱形代码

VS2010下,新建空项目,添加源文件,将代码粘贴进去就可以了. 通过改maxRows值的大小,可以控制菱形的大小 #include <stdio.h> #include<cstdlib> //添加依赖的头文件 void main() { int i,j,k; int maxRows = 12;//控制菱形的大小 //先打印上边的四行 for(i=1;i<maxRows;i++) { for(j=1;j<maxRows-i;j++)//控制要打印的空格数 printf(

c++命令提示符窗体下打印指定大小的菱形代码

VS2010下,新建空项目.加入源文件,将代码粘贴进去就能够了. 通过改maxRows值的大小,能够控制菱形的大小 #include <stdio.h> #include<cstdlib> //加入依赖的头文件 void main() { int i,j,k; int maxRows = 12;//控制菱形的大小 //先打印上边的四行 for(i=1;i<maxRows;i++) { for(j=1;j<maxRows-i;j++)//控制要打印的空格数 printf(

输出菱形代码

public class sanjiaoxing3 { //菱形 public static void main(String[] args) { int m=4; for (int i=0;i<=m;i++){ for(int j=0;j<=3-i;j++){ System.out.print(" "); } for(int j=0;j<=i;j++){ System.out.print(" *"); } System.out.println()

C语言打印各种图形

C语言中用循环可以打印出各种图形 1 直角三角形(靠右直立):部分代码 int i,j; for (i=0; i<6; i++) { for (j=6;j>i ;j-- ) { printf(" "); } for (j=0; j<=i; j++) { printf("*"); } printf("\n"); } 运行效果: 还有各种直角三角形就不一一介绍了. 2.等腰三角形(直立)部分代码如下: int i,j; for (i

图形打印

一步就把菱形打印出来比较困难,可以先分步骤来实现 首先打印出四分之一个菱形 代码如下: <?php //打印菱形 $a=5; for($i=1;$i<=$a;$i++){ //第一层 控制行数 for($j=1;$j<=$i;$j++){ echo("*"); } echo "<br />"; } ?> 运行结果 * ** *** **** ***** 第二步打印半个 代码如下: <?php //打印菱形 $a=5; for

【JS中循环嵌套六大经典例题+六大图形题,你知道哪几个?】

首先,了解一下循环嵌套的特点:外层循环转一次,内层循环转一圈. 在上一篇随笔中详细介绍了JS中的分支结构和循环结构,我们来简单的回顾一下For循环结构: 1.for循环有三个表达式,分别为: ①定义循环变量 ② 判断循环条件 ③更新循环变量(三个表达式之间,用;分隔.) for循环三个表达式可以省略,两个;缺一不可2.for循环特点:先判断,再执行:3.for循环三个表达式,均可以有多部分组成,之间用逗号分隔,但是第二部分判断条件需要用&&链接,最终结果需要为真/假. [嵌套循环特点]外层

小纪a

感觉挺好的两段代码:虽然已经存在,但是这是我自己敲出来的,没有照抄,真心话,所以记录下来. 1.菱形代码: #include <stdio.h>void main() { int i, j; for(i = 0; i < 4; i++) { for(j = 0; j < 3 - i; j++) { printf(" "); } for(j = 0; j < 2 * i + 1; j++) { printf("*"); } printf(

错误和问题解决的成本

问题描写叙述 错误 数据收集 根本原因 版本号   组件:数据修复           在一个实际成本组织中,(平均,先进先出,后进先出) 一个或更 多的下面情况可能发生: 1.导航到物料成本历史表单上的数量信息,与现有量表单的数量不匹配的记录 2. 一些物料前期已计成本的数量与前面的事务处理历史表单的数量不匹配 3. 全部的库存值报表与事务处理值报表不匹配 4. 存货层次成本更新表单的总数量与现有量数量表单不匹配(只在先进先出/后进先出) 5.这些症状的不论什么一个意味着 MMT-CQL不匹配

CSS3实现的菱形效果代码实例

CSS3实现的菱形效果代码实例:本章节分享一段代码实例,它使用CSS3实现了菱形效果.代码如下: <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<meta name="author" content="http://www.softwhy.com/" /> <title>蚂蚁部落</title> <